Home > Return Code > Cmd Exit /b

Cmd Exit /b

Contents

Before posting on our computer help forum, you must register. How can I forget children toys riffs? Browse other questions tagged windows command-line unix or ask your own question. Not all MS commands fail with errorlevel 1.

We also pass a specific non-zero return code from the failed command to inform the caller of our script about the failure. This type of compare ("%errorlevel%=="0") becomes dubious at best.B.bat can use the exit statement to pass a return code (errorlevel) back to a.bat.QuoteQuits the CMD.EXE program (command interpreter) or the current A successful command returns a 0 while an unsuccessful one returns a non-zero value that usually can be interpreted as an Error Code. Related 213Stop and Start a service via batch or cmd file?499Windows batch files: .bat vs .cmd?1411Is there an equivalent of 'which' on the Windows command line?487How do I get the application

Cmd Exit /b

why is Newton's method not widely used in machine learning? Exit Exits the current batch script or the Cmd.exe program (that is, the command interpreter) and returns to the program that started Cmd.exe or to the Program Manager. If quitting CMD.EXE, sets the process exit code with that number.That's exactly what I was looking for!Thanks a lot!Works like a charm!Gabor Logged billrich Guest more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ed

but you need to catch that in the .bat and re-raise it to app1... What is plausible biology of ocean-dwelling, tool-using, intelligent creatures? In the case of an infinite loop, this EXIT /b behaviour will cause the script to hang until manually terminated with Ctrl + C Exiting nested FOR loops, if EXIT /b Windows Exit Code Water leaks on passengers side feet when raining Episode From Old Sci-fi TV Series What is plausible biology of ocean-dwelling, tool-using, intelligent creatures?

Jumping to EOF in this way will exit your current script with the return code of 1. Manage Your Profile | Site Feedback Site Feedback x Tell us about your experience... Return Code Conventions By convention, command line execution should return zero when execution succeeds and non-zero when execution fails. Thanks very much! –The Mask May 28 '14 at 0:56 1 Another reason why it might not work (always zero) is when it's inside an if or for.

Appropriate synonym for lights brightening gently Does SQL Server cache the result of a multi-statement table-valued function? Batch File Exit Code 1 Computer Hope Forum Main pageFree helpTipsDictionaryForumLinksContact Welcome, Guest. If quitting CMD.EXE, set the process exit code no. This document provides steps on how to return the error codes on .vb scripts, Powershell scripts and batch files.

Windows Batch File Return Code

more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ed Learning resources Microsoft Virtual Academy Channel 9 MSDN Magazine Community Forums Blogs Codeplex Support Self support Programs BizSpark (for startups) Microsoft Imagine (for students) United States (English) Newsletter Privacy & cookies Cmd Exit /b The last command executed in the function or the script determines the exit status. Cmd Errorlevel What do I do when using cmd.exe on Windows?

I also recommend documenting your possible return codes with easy to read SET statements at the top of your script file, like this: SET /A ERROR_HELP_SCREEN=1 SET /A ERROR_FILE_NOT_FOUND=2 Note that I’m underwater most of the time, and music is like a tube to the surface that I can breathe through. Could someone please help with these questions:How do I return 0 for success ate the end of an MSDOS batch file?Similarly, how do I return 1 (or other values) representing erroneous asked 6 years ago viewed 9147 times active 4 years ago Related 8Exit program in windows command prompt51Execute multiple commands with 1 line in Windows commandline?2Command Line replacements for Windows Vista23Is Cmd Set Errorlevel

  • Why does Hermione dislike Professor Trelawney from the start?
  • See "if /?".
  • share|improve this answer edited Oct 1 '10 at 5:27 answered Oct 1 '10 at 4:58 Dennis Williamson 59.6k11107142 I tried your code.
  • devcomApprenticeThanked: 37 Re: How to return success/failure from a batch file? « Reply #8 on: September 10, 2008, 01:12:38 AM » you can use:Code: [Select]&& if success
    || if failexample:Code: [Select]set
  • share|improve this answer edited Aug 16 '11 at 12:44 svick 129k25206319 answered Dec 2 '08 at 18:09 Adam Rosenfield 248k66382496 6 It's not an actual environment variable (which is, obviously,
  • Command-Line Exit Codes Visual Studio 2010 Other Versions Visual Studio 2008 Visual Studio 2005 The Team Foundation version control command-line utility tf provides exit codes that indicate the level of success
  • Statements about groups proved using semigroups How could Talia Winters help the rogue telepaths against Bester?
  • Happened when checking %ERRORLEVEL% in a cmd file.
  • I did not know about that command.

If > 0, then the .bat exits and sets errorlevel to 1 for the calling app1. See ASP.NET Ajax CDN Terms of Use – http://www.asp.net/ajaxlibrary/CDN.ashx. ]]> TechNet Products Products Windows Windows Server System Center Browser If those answers do not fully address your question, please ask a new question. Not the answer you're looking for?

asked 6 years ago viewed 97623 times active 3 years ago Linked 0 CMD - Successful or not indication? Errorlevel Codes Microsoft Customer Support Microsoft Community Forums United States (English) Sign in Home Library Wiki Learn Gallery Downloads Support Forums Blogs We’re sorry. What's the English word for something that given attention too much to Episode From Old Sci-fi TV Series When to use the emergency brake in a train?

Example: Batch file for Copying File to a Folder md "C:manageengine" copy "\\sharename\foldername\samplefile.txt" "C:\manageengine" exit /b %ERRORLEVEL% Exit codes for powershell script Use the command Exit $LASTEXITCODE at the end of

To know about Environment variable see the below note. instead, as described in this answer. –romkyns Apr 8 '15 at 22:36 This worked great for me, I had a bit of a complex situation. –Chef Pharaoh Dec 20 XCOPY, for instance can fail with errorlevels 1 to 5. Cmd Return Code 1 Effects of bullets firing while in a handgun's magazine Why is ammonium a weak acid if ammonia is a weak base?

Welcome guest. if /B is specified, sets ERRORLEVEL that number. Exit will return custom return codes from the script Example: Powershell script for copying file to a folder $dest ="C: est" New-Item $dest -type directory -force $source ="c:samplefile.txt" alfpsNewbie Experience: Expert OS: Windows 7 Re: How to return success/failure from a batch file? « Reply #12 on: December 06, 2014, 08:01:33 AM » Quote from: grevesz on September 09,